Symptoms
A reseller has allow-emaillimits-pkgs disabled and wants to create a package with a custom "Maximum Hourly Email by Domain Relayed" setting and can't make a change.
Description
In WHM under Tweak Settings the Max Hourly Emal setting sets a cap that is the max allowed that can be set in a package if a reseller has allow-emaillimits-pkgs disabled. The reseller is not able to adjust this lower if desired.
We've opened an internal case for our development team to investigate this further. For reference, the case number is CPANEL-46983. Follow this article to receive an email notification when a solution is published in the product.
Workaround
There presently is no workaround.
